范衍静

邮箱:fanyanjing@lcu.edu.cn 

 

 

 

讲授课程

本科生课程:组织学与胚胎学,组织学与胚胎学实验;病理学,病理学实验

主要研究方向

1.过敏性鼻炎

2. 过敏性哮喘

承担科研项目

博士科研启动基金项目,咖啡因对PM2.5暴露后过敏性鼻炎-哮喘综合症(CARAS)的影响机制研究,主持,可用经费8万元
